Walter John Rubach, Jr.

Walter John Rubach, Jr., 87, of Snook, passed away peacefully on Thursday, November 28, 2024.

A graveside service will be held at 2:00 p.m. at Snook Cemetery in Snook, on Thursday, December 5, 2024.

Walter was born on Saturday, October 16, 1937, in Snook.

He was the oldest of three born to Mr. Walter John Rubach, Sr. and Lydia Marie Rubach (Pecal) in Snook.

Walter grew up farming and loved the land.

He was known for his love of people and of course, hunting and fishing.

Walter graduated from Snook High School and went on to Blinn College, followed by Sam Houston State where he majored in Education. He taught school in Snook, teaching science and driver’s education.

He loved his community and was not only a dedicated educator but a loyal friend and neighbor. He was kind and generous to all who knew him.

Walter was preceded in death by his parents; and brother-in-law, Walter Maas.

He is survived by his brother, Dr. Alton Rubach; and sister, Linda (Rubach) Maas; as well as numerous nieces and nephews as well as devoted friends.
